It is a big *** cam but depending on your tuner it can be tamed. My tuner said he couldn't get my tune on due to the FIC injectors(not sure how true this is)but it is not terrible. On the street you can cruse at 1800 rpm while giving it little throttle and it wont surge/buck until you lug it... which is expected. I cruse around 2-2300rpm and have no issues. I put out 440/400 with LS6 intake/pacesetter headers and cheap restrictive cai. Hoping for 450 with the LS1 lid. With the CNCd trick flows and a 90/90 470+ would be easy IMO. Car also trapped 116 in the 1/4 with a 2.2 60'.
BTW this is with the rev limiter at 6500. The cam pulls past that so plan on doing katech rod bolts and spinning to 6800/7k.
